Many of you have brought good questions to mind. I'll give you a little background on some of my design decisions. 

I'm a designer who really feels that you must design for the audience, and what will really connect.

For some of the logos that feel like a "soccer" crest. That is intentional. 

In the NFL, and most of the NHL, you see logos that don't really have must text applied with the main logo. I've tried to accomplish the same effect with most of these logos. There were some I feel that still needed text. I wanted to see if I combine a strong symbol/soccer crest/nba style logo into one logo.

 

Here is a little background on each NBA logo and why I did what I did.

Atlanta Hawks: Wanted to stay true to the classic look and feel yet give the hawk a little more aggressive look and one that feels like the hawk is looking over/protecting the city.

Boston Celtics: Honestly, I wanted to try something totally different.

Brooklyn Nets: Stay true to Brooklyn. I kept the shield from the current logo, but really wanted the bridge, as a way of tying Brooklyn to New York City.

Charlotte Hornets: I wanted to put a modern twist on one of the old original Hornets logos that lasted only one season.

Chicago Bulls: Tried to update a classic. It's difficult.

Cleveland Cavaliers: I love the current color scheme but I feel Cleveland needs to stick to the "Wine & gold" scheme. I really wanted to keep this mark really simple.

Dallas Mavericks: Put a modern twist on a classic. ( I may change this one too. Still looking at other options I did.)

Denver Nuggets: I wanted to combine the shield of the Colorado Rapids in this one. Honestly, I think Denver is a city that could find a design element for all their professional sports teams and use it across the board. That is what I went into with Nuggets. 

Detroit Pistons: Wanted to show a classic grill for a classic team with a classic name. ( I still may change this one too)

Golden State Warriors: Reason for "SF", is i'm honestly just preparing for when the team goes to San Francisco. That is all.

Houston Rockets: I wanted to use a design of a rocket shape patch, and use the classic rocket scheme.

Indiana Pacers: Update a modern look and really tie in what makes Indiana great.

Los Angeles Clippers: I had to do something to fix that horrible mess that they have made.

Los Angeles Lakers: I combined the letter type of the old MLPS Lakers, and the ball of the current Lakers logo. Tried to stay true to history and tradition.

Memphis Grizzlies: (one of my projects on my website, Seattle Kodiaks, that logo was supposed to be used for Memphis). This was a difficult one to come up with. Stay true to the "memphis blues".

Miami Heat: Most difficult one to complete. I know soccer is huge down there so I tried combining a soccer style logo with an NBA twist.

Milwaukee Bucks: Honestly, I'm not a huge fan of their new logo (love the uniforms though). I just tried to put what my version would be.

Minnesota Timberwolves: Put a modern twist on a classic. 

New Orleans Pelicans: I really wanted to incorporate the "Pelicans" name, and I hoped by using the fluer-dis-lee I could show it's New Orleans team.

New York Knicks: A badge of the NYPD, the empire state building, and basketball.... Screams I am a KNICK!

Oklahoma City Thunder: Thundering herds of buffaloes yet put a Native American tie to it.

Orlando Magic: Tried combine the sight of Magic into a logo. 

Philadelphia 76ers: Show my own version.

Phoenix Suns: Wanted to show a "phoenix" bird that covers all of the state of Arizona.

Portland TrailBlazers: Yes, I tried combine as well another MLS look into this logo. I know the pinwheel logo is a classic, so I tried to use "5 lines" on both sides of the axe to try to give the same type of feel.

Sacramento Kings: Incorporate a crown in the game of basketball.

San Antonio Spurs: A twist and view of a classic spur.

Toronto Raptors: I miss the old ball/claw logo. It was perfect. So I wanted to keep the claws, along with the leaf to really show that the Raptors are not only Toronto's team, but Canada's team as well.

Utah Jazz: I live and breathe the Jazz (season ticket holder as well). This one, honestly I just wanted to do something with music, and a new style of note for the team.

Washington Wizards: Show the monument as part of DC, and incorporate the Nations Capital. 

 

I know that this may not be enough explanation on each team, but it gives you an idea of what I was thinking when wanting to make certain design decisions.
